When it comes to choosing the perfect wedding vows, many couples turn to the wisdom found in the Bible. These verses offer not only guidance but also a deep reflection on the sanctity of marriage, love, and commitment. By incorporating biblical principles, couples can create vows that resonate with both their hearts and their faith.
Throughout the Bible, we find powerful words that encapsulate the essence of true love and partnership. The following 30 scriptures will inspire you to express your devotion and commitment on your special day, ensuring that your vows are not only heartfelt but also grounded in timeless truth.

Seeking Divine Guidance for Wedding Vows
Dear Lord,
As we gather to celebrate the union of two hearts in love, we seek Your wisdom and grace. Help the couple to articulate their deepest promises in a way that honors You and reflects the beauty of their commitment.
Guide them in choosing words that express their devotion, sincerity, and faithfulness. May their vows be a testament to the love modeled by Christ, filled with compassion, patience, and understanding.
Let them remember that their promises are a covenant not only with each other but also with You. Strengthen them to uphold their vows through joys and trials alike, and may their love be a light to those around them.
We trust in Your support and blessing upon their marriage, knowing that with You at the center, their love will flourish.
In Jesus’ name, Amen.
